Design to use TCPoly's Thermally Conductive Material.
Engineered in OpenSCAD.
This is a filled filament so you will need a hardened nozzle, I recommend a 0.6mm Nozzle X.
Printer settings.
0.6mm Nozzle.
0.3mm Layer Height.
30mm/s Print Speed.
100% Infill.
250C Nozzle.
80C Bed.
I recommend printing onto masking tape.
